How to Convert 43 Kilograms to Pounds

The formula for converting kilograms to pounds is straightforward:

Weight in pounds = Weight in kilograms × 2.20462

This means you multiply the number of kilograms by approximately 2.20462 to get the equivalent weight in pounds.

Applying the Formula to 43 kg

Using this formula, let’s convert 43 kilograms to pounds:

43 kg × 2.20462 ≈ 94.798 pounds

So, 43 kilograms is approximately 94.8 pounds.

Tips for Easily Converting Kilograms to Pounds in Your Head

If you don’t have a calculator handy, here are some mental math tips to approximate kilograms to pounds quickly:

  1. Double and Add 10%: Multiply the kilogram number by 2, then add roughly 10% of that number. For example, for 43 kg:
    • 43 × 2 = 86
    • 10% of 86 = 8.6
    • 86 + 8.6 ≈ 94.6 pounds
  2. Round and Adjust: Round kilograms to the nearest 5 or 10 for easy multiplication, then fine-tune. For 43 kg, round to 40 kg (88 pounds) and add the difference for 3 kg (about 6.6 pounds) to get roughly 94.6 pounds.

While these methods are approximate, they often provide a close enough estimate for casual use.

Historical Context of Weight Measurements

The coexistence of kilograms and pounds is rooted in historical measurement systems. The kilogram was introduced in France in the late 18th century as part of the metric system’s establishment, aiming for universal standardization. Meanwhile, pounds have origins tracing back to Roman and Anglo-Saxon times, evolving through centuries of customary use.
